Paul (Ernie) Mascarenas passed away peacefully on November 13, 2024, at the age of 65, in the loving arms of his partner, Rowell (RC) Madison, after a nine-month battle with stage 4 pancreatic cancer that metastasized to his lungs. He is now reunited with his father, Candido Mascarenas; mother, Lucille Mascarenas; mother-in-law, Geraldine Madison; sister-in-law, Rachel Madison; and brother-in-law, Ralph Madison. Paul leaves behind his devoted partner, Rowell Madison; his sisters Irene (Steve) Duran and Sylvia Abeyta; his brothers Arnold (Annette) Mascarenas and Andrew (Christine) Mascarenas; brother-in-law, Raoul (Gayle) Madison; sister-in-law, Ruth Madison; and many nieces, nephews, and extended family.

Born in Bluewater, New Mexico, on May 13, 1959, Paul graduated from New Mexico State University in Las Cruces with an undergraduate degree in 1982. He later earned a Master of Business Administration in Human Resource Management from San Diego State University in 1995. Paul had a deep love for life and cherished many hobbies, including cooking, music, playing guitar, photography, and exploring new technology.

Paul met his life partner, Rowell, on August 26, 1984, in Minneapolis, Minnesota. They moved to San Diego, California, in 1986, where they spent the next 40 years together, building a life filled with love and shared passions. Some of their fondest memories include ice skating, attending theater and musicals, camping, swimming, sailing on Minnesota’s 10,000 lakes, rollerblading on the beaches of Southern California, taking road trips, dining out, gardening, quilting, and canning jams. They also enjoyed long walks together and cherished their two beloved cats, Chitauqua (Chichi) and Tabatha (Tabby), who accompanied them on many camping trips.

In their professional lives, Paul and Rowell worked together, making significant contributions to the community. They operated a small business for over ten years selling outdoor garden art and accessories. Paul spent the last 19 years as a janitorial franchise sales representative for Jan-Pro of San Diego, where he was recognized as playing a key role in the success of over 150 franchise owners and their families. Outside of work, they gave back to their community by volunteering with homeless and blind communities in San Diego. They also served as conservators for their elderly neighbor who struggled with mental illness.

After 35 happy years together, Paul and Rowell married on New Year’s Eve, 2019, in San Diego. The following year, they moved to New Mexico to honor and care for Paul’s father. Sadly, Paul’s father passed away just two short weeks after him, on Thanksgiving Day 2024.

Rowell will forever cherish their final year together—the joy of completing a framed puzzle, the memories of a day trip across New Mexico’s ten counties, and their unforgettable vacation to Yosemite National Park. “Until our paths meet again, and we can simply sit and listen to the robins sing, ‘I will always love you…’”

Paul’s memory will remain in our hearts forever, as his legacy is not measured by the length of his life but by the depth of it. A celebration of Paul’s life will be held in the Spring of 2025 for family, friends, and neighbors in the beautiful garden he designed in Albuquerque, New Mexico, for Rowell.

Donations may be made to The Trevor Project—Saving Young LGBTQ+ Lives, in honor of Paul’s memory.
